Understanding Trade-In Programs with Xfinity

Trade-in programs allow you to exchange your old device for credit towards a new purchase or bill reduction. Xfinity offers a streamlined trade-in process designed to be quick and convenient.

Advantages of Trading In

  • Immediate credit applied to your account or new device purchase.
  • Less hassle compared to selling privately.
  • Environmental benefits through proper device recycling.

Disadvantages of Trading In

  • Potentially lower value compared to private sales.
  • Restrictions based on device condition and model.
  • Limited flexibility on the final value offered.

Direct Selling of Your Phone

Direct sales involve selling your device to another individual or through third-party platforms. This method can often yield higher returns but requires more effort and security considerations.

Advantages of Direct Sales

  • Potentially higher sale price.
  • Full control over the sale process and price.
  • Flexibility to sell to whomever you choose.

Disadvantages of Direct Sales

  • Time-consuming process involving listings and negotiations.
  • Risk of scams or fraud.
  • Need for secure payment and safe transaction methods.

Comparing Trade-In and Direct Sales with Xfinity

Choosing between trade-in and direct sales depends on your priorities. If convenience and speed are essential, Xfinity’s trade-in program offers a straightforward solution. However, if maximizing your device’s value is your goal, direct selling might be more profitable.

Factors to Consider

  • Time: Trade-in is faster; direct sales require effort and patience.
  • Value: Private sales often fetch higher prices.
  • Security: Trade-in reduces risk; direct sales require caution.
  • Environmental Impact: Trade-in supports recycling initiatives.
